Rule 33
Evaluation of seniority
: While giving seniority points to police personnel, a maximum of twenty twenty points will be given at the rate of two points for each year of service in the currently held position. But,
(a) Marks will be given in terms of Damasahi for Chanchun months or days exceeding one year.
(b) Seniority for the period in which Gayalkatti took place will not be given marks.
(c) While calculating the points for promotion in the case of the following police personnel, the service period of the following posts will be calculated and the points will be given:-
